Transaction ab31ea02261115b1b94e0f6e3a066abed4e5d8400c6662a2a546783e092820f2
3 Input
1 Outputs
- ab31ea02261115b1b94e0f6e3a066abed4e5d8400c6662a2a546783e092820f2:0
value 84377916
address 39oM6nD6SrTashAJnud8iLfSEgRD8mgeWF